Porosity analysis of long-fiber-reinforced ceramic matrix composites using X-ray tomography

Description

This study has been devoted to a volumetric exploration of the meso-structure of a two-dimensional SiCf-SiC composite with cross-weave fibers using X-ray tomography. A series of projection images have been used to reconstruct the three-dimensional composite's architecture and a quantitative analysis of the morphology of the porosity network has been carried out in order to characterize the fiber-tissue structure. The suitability of X-ray tomography for characterizing this structural material at a meso-scale level is critically assessed
